Introduction to Shopify

Shopify is one of the leading e-commerce platforms globally, offering entrepreneurs and businesses a comprehensive solution to create, manage, and grow their online stores. With its user-friendly interface, extensive features, and robust support, Shopify has become the go-to choice for over a million businesses. This guide provides an in-depth review of Shopify, covering its features, pricing, pros, cons, and how it compares to other platforms.

Overview of Shopify Features

User-Friendly Interface

One of the standout features of Shopify is its intuitive and easy-to-use interface. Whether you are a seasoned developer or a novice in the e-commerce world, Shopify makes it easy to set up and manage your store. The drag-and-drop editor allows you to customize your storefront without needing any coding knowledge.

Extensive Theme Collection

Shopify offers a vast collection of themes, both free and paid, designed to suit various industries and styles. These themes are responsive, ensuring that your store looks great on both desktop and mobile devices.

App Store

The Shopify App Store boasts over 6,000 apps, providing functionalities ranging from marketing automation, SEO optimization, customer support, and inventory management. This extensive range allows businesses to tailor their stores to meet specific needs and improve overall efficiency.

Payment Gateways

Shopify supports over 100 payment gateways, including PayPal, Stripe, and its own Shopify Payments. This flexibility ensures that you can offer your customers their preferred payment methods, enhancing their shopping experience.

SEO and Marketing Tools

Shopify is equipped with built-in SEO features, including customizable title tags, meta descriptions, and URL handles. Additionally, Shopify supports social media integration, email marketing, and offers robust analytics to track your store’s performance.

Security

Security is a top priority for Shopify. The platform is PCI DSS compliant, ensuring that your customers’ payment information is secure. Regular updates and robust hosting infrastructure further protect your store from cyber threats.

Shopify Pricing Plans

Shopify offers several pricing plans to accommodate businesses of all sizes. Here’s a breakdown:

Basic Shopify

  • Cost: $29/month
  • Features: Basic online store functionality, unlimited products, 24/7 support, discount codes, and manual order creation.

Shopify

  • Cost: $79/month
  • Features: Everything in Basic, plus professional reports, gift cards, and lower credit card fees.

Advanced Shopify

  • Cost: $299/month
  • Features: Everything in Shopify, plus advanced report builder, third-party calculated shipping rates, and even lower credit card fees.

Shopify Plus

  • Cost: Custom pricing
  • Features: Tailored for large enterprises, offering advanced customization, higher-level support, and more.

Pros of Shopify

Easy to Use

Shopify’s user-friendly interface and comprehensive guides make it easy for anyone to start and manage an online store.

Customizable

With a wide range of themes and apps, you can create a unique shopping experience tailored to your brand.

Scalable

Whether you’re just starting or have a high-volume business, Shopify scales with your needs, offering solutions for small businesses and large enterprises alike.

Reliable Support

Shopify offers 24/7 support via phone, email, and live chat. The platform also has a comprehensive help center and active community forums.

Mobile-Friendly

All Shopify themes are responsive, ensuring that your store looks great on any device. This is crucial as mobile shopping continues to grow.

Cons of Shopify

Cost

While Shopify offers various plans, the costs can add up, especially when you factor in transaction fees, premium themes, and apps.

Limited Customization

For highly specific customizations, you may need to dive into the code or hire a developer, which can be an additional expense.

Transaction Fees

Unless you use Shopify Payments, you will incur transaction fees for each sale, which can eat into your profits.

Shopify vs. Competitors

Shopify vs. WooCommerce

WooCommerce is a popular WordPress plugin that turns a WordPress site into an e-commerce store. Here’s how it compares to Shopify:

  • Ease of Use: Shopify is generally easier to set up and manage, while WooCommerce requires more technical knowledge.
  • Customization: WooCommerce offers more customization options since it’s open-source, but this also means you may need more technical skills.
  • Cost: WooCommerce can be cheaper, but costs can add up with hosting, security, and additional plugins.

Shopify vs. BigCommerce

BigCommerce is another leading e-commerce platform. Here’s a comparison:

  • Ease of Use: Both platforms are user-friendly, but Shopify has a slight edge in terms of simplicity.
  • Features: BigCommerce offers more built-in features, reducing the need for additional apps.
  • Scalability: Both platforms are highly scalable, but Shopify Plus offers more advanced features for large enterprises.

Shopify vs. Squarespace

Squarespace is known for its stunning templates and ease of use for building websites. Here’s how it stacks up against Shopify:

  • Ease of Use: Squarespace is very user-friendly, but Shopify is specifically designed for e-commerce, making it better for online stores.
  • Design: Squarespace offers more aesthetically pleasing templates, but Shopify’s themes are highly customizable.
  • E-commerce Features: Shopify offers more robust e-commerce features compared to Squarespace.

Tips for Maximizing Your Shopify Experience

Utilize Free Trials

Take advantage of Shopify’s 14-day free trial to explore the platform and see if it meets your needs before committing to a paid plan.

Explore the App Store

Browse the Shopify App Store to find apps that can enhance your store’s functionality, from marketing tools to customer support integrations.

Invest in a Good Theme

A well-designed theme can significantly impact your store’s appearance and user experience. Consider investing in a premium theme that aligns with your brand.

Optimize for SEO

Use Shopify’s built-in SEO tools to optimize your store for search engines. This includes customizing title tags, meta descriptions, and alt texts for images.

Engage with the Community

Join Shopify community forums and groups to connect with other store owners, share experiences, and gain valuable insights.
